Zargan ol Basreh (Persian: زرگان البصره) is a village in, and the capital of, Zargan Rural District of Veys District, Bavi County, Khuzestan province, Iran.[3]

The National Census in 2011 counted 736 people in 170 households. The latest census in 2016 showed a population of 795 people in 202 households.[2]
